2 There is simply nothing like it! Take a deep breath. Catch the scent of pine cones and roasting marshmallows, and you are ready for your summer camp adventure. There are leaves to rustle through, water to plunge into and trails to explore. There are campfire stories that make you laugh and shiver, like the night air causing you to snuggle deeper into the warmth of your sleeping bag drifting off to dream of the fun you ll have tomorrow. At summer camp you can come for the day, for 3, 5 or even 12 nights. You can bring a buddy or come on your own, but in no time you will know all the girls in your camping unit just like your friends back home. That is just the nature of summer camp friends made summer after summer often become your friends for life. You might even come to camp with your whole troop or with your favorite woman! Camp Evelyn is near Plymouth, WI. We have a beautiful lake, a flowing river and a sparkling swimming pool. Camp Manitou in Shoto, WI is on the banks of Serenity Lake in Manitowoc County and is graced with deep forests, rolling trails and even a frisbee golf course. Try your hand at kayaking, art, music, paddleboard, swimming and campfires, discovering the constellations, experiments, and archery. Summer camp is open to all girls entering 1st-12th grade. Not a Girl Scout? Simply add $25 to the camp fee to become a member, and join in the fun! Bring your friends and show them how to have a blast this summer! 1

6 Rock the Summer at Camp Manitou Sessions below are at Camp Manitou. Bits and Bridles at Camp Manitou Girls entering grades 5-12, let your inner horsewoman shine! Learn basic horseback riding, grooming, and stable management. We will start from the beginning and build your equestrian skills, spending at least two hours a day at the stable. You ll have plenty of time to explore Camp Manitou and Serenity Lake, to swim, kayak, stand-up paddle board, hike, geocache and play disc golf. There will be plenty of room for your horse riding gear, including long pants and sturdy shoes with heels, because you will camp in a Camp Manitou building during this session. Earn and receive the appropriate equestrian badge for your age level. 3-Night: June 24-27, $380. Water Adventures at Camp Manitou Your dreams of living your life on a beach are about to come true. You ll wake up, and the first step out of your tent will be onto Serenity Beach. You ll canoe, kayak, stand-up paddleboard, fish, and compete for the best sand scultpture! You ll travel to Woodland Dunes Nature Center to explore waterfronts and wetlands, and take action to keep them clean and healthy for wildlife. For girls entering grades Night: July 29-August 1, $260 Summer Camp with your Troop Together Outdoor Discovery Troop Camp at Camp Manitou - all grades Are you ready for a rustic camp experience with your troop mates? Grab your tents and let s go! You and your friends will learn outdoor survival skills like knot tying, shelter building and orienteering. Enjoy meals over the camp fire and sing camp songs as you hike in the woods. To top off your Camp Manitou adventure you can paddle your way around Serenity Lake on a paddle board or kayak and climb a ROCK WALL! Be ready for some wild surprises too! The camping fee includes all activities, camping space, bathroom/shower access, drinking water, wood, matches, paper, cooking equipment, picnic table, and a fire ring. Troops must bring their own food (including snacks and beverages), tents, sleeping gear and any special supplies. An adult who has completed Outdoor Adventures Training must accompany each troop. Adults will be responsible for the supervision of their troop and should consult Safety Activity Checkpoints when making plans. Everyone attending must be a registered Girl Scout member, including adults. August 19 at 2 pm to August 21 at 6:15 pm, $60 per person. 5

Buddy Request Campers may request to be placed in the same unit as her friend(s). To ensure this, please list your camper s buddy(s) name(s) on her registration form. Buddies must register for the same session and dates. Health Documentation Requirements Each camper staying 5 nights or more must provide documentation of a health assessment conducted by a medical professional within the last 24 months, a health history and an immunization record. 7 Campers staying 4 nights or less must provide a health history, although an assessment and immunization record may be submitted to be kept on file for future summer camping.

9 Life at Camp Evelyn Delicious Meals There is nothing like activity and fresh air to make a girl HUNGRY! Camp meals and snacks are healthy and are foods kids like. Most meals are prepared by our cooks and eaten in the dining hall, and girls also cook at least one meal themselves outdoors, maybe more. Most diets (gluten free, diabetic, kosher, vegetarian, vegan, allergies, etc.) can be accomodated by contacting the director of camp and program two weeks prior to the stay at camp. Campers with dietary restrictions are welcome to bring a few alternative meals if they wish. Sweet Dreams You ll sleep on cots covered with mosquito netting in tents set up on raised platforms or in cabins. Counselors sleep in tents or cabins that are VERY close by, but not in the same tents or cabins as girls. Kapers Kapers are chores, important in Girl Scouting, to learn that everyone must do their share. In small groups, you ll take turns doing kapers like setting and clearing dining hall tables, sweeping, raising and lowering the flag and keeping camp beautiful. Special Needs Camp Evelyn can accommodate most physical, medical, developmental, dietary, behavioral or communications needs. Contact the director of camp and program to discuss the camp session and specific needs. Safety is priority-one at camp Our staff complete intense training in how to keep girls safe while still having lots of fun. Camp Evelyn is operated by the standards of Girl Scouts of the USA, which meet or exceed the standards of the local and state health departments. All staff pass a thorough screening process including criminal and sexual offender background checks. Each staff member is certified in CPR and first aid and many are lifeguards. A qualified health supervisor is on-site at all times, and a doctor is on-call. Those picking up campers must be listed on the transportation form completed by the parent and show photo ID. 8

10 Three varieties of fun at Camp! All-Camp Action Girl Scouts love the magic that comes only from a large group all together, so a few times per week the whole camp gets together for talent shows, campfires, kickball games, karaoke dance parties, capture the flag, carnivals, scavenger hunts, pool parties, guest presenters, skits and songs. If all the girls can imagine it, all the girls can make it happen all over camp. Unit Unity The girls who live together in your camp community, called a unit become your closest friends. They are close to your age, and you experience so much together. You choose the activities to dive into as a group. Maybe you ll stay up late and hear stories of the constellations, or form a noodle train in the pool, cook-out your supper, conquer an obstacle course, jump in Crystal Lake, or inspire each other with your art and science projects. Individual Adventures Because each of us is special, with special talents and interests, at least three times per day you ll get to choose an activity that is open to girls from the entire camp, not just your unit. You ll make new friends and try activities that might not be selected by your unit mates. River stomping, archery, unique arts, SUP, kayaking, cooking, outdoor baking, and games and sports are among the many choices.
